[trunk] 7.0 Error on opening Manufacturing in Settings

Bug #1071178 reported by Emiliyan Tanev
18
This bug affects 2 people
Affects Status Importance Assigned to Milestone
Odoo Addons (MOVED TO GITHUB)
Fix Released
Medium
OpenERP R&D Addons Team 2

Bug Description

http://trunk_23130.runbot.openerp.com

There is server error when I try to open menu item Manufacturing in Settings. Attached is video.

 modules.append((name, ir_module.browse(cr, uid, mod_ids[0], context)))
IndexError: list index out of range

Related branches

Revision history for this message
Emiliyan Tanev (em-tanev) wrote :
affects: openobject-addons → openobject-server
Changed in openobject-server:
assignee: nobody → OpenERP's Framework R&D (openerp-dev-framework)
importance: Undecided → Medium
status: New → Confirmed
Revision history for this message
ajay javiya (OpenERP) (aja-openerp) wrote :

Hello Emiliyan,

Certaily I do agree with your Bug post and It is Re-produable bug with lattest trunk. We investigated the issue and found problem in mrp res.config wizard. Previouly we had a module named `mrp_subproduct` but the module has been refectored and renamed to the `mrp_byproduct` and MErged in trunk at Revision#7846 [1]. This refectore missed few of them changes.

@Jignesh : This No logner affects the Server Project rather is affects Addons. So Kindly Do necessary changes.

I have created the branch have committed fix [2] and Few more refector related to the Changes in Servral Commit. and Have Requested the Merge Proposal in trunk.

Thank You
---
 [1] http://bazaar.launchpad.net/~openerp-dev/openobject-addons/trunk-10click-mrp/revision/7846
 [2] https://code.launchpad.net/~openerp-dev/openobject-addons/trunk-bug-1071178-aja

Changed in openobject-server:
status: Confirmed → Fix Committed
affects: openobject-server → openobject-addons
Changed in openobject-addons:
assignee: OpenERP's Framework R&D (openerp-dev-framework) → nobody
assignee: nobody → OpenERP R&D Addons Team 2 (openerp-dev-addons2)
Revision history for this message
Cedric Snauwaert (OpenERP) (csn-openerp) wrote :

Hello,

The fix has been merged in trunk
 - rev number : 7950
 - rev id : <email address hidden>

Thanks a lot for your work,

Cédric

Changed in openobject-addons:
status: Fix Committed → Fix Released
Revision history for this message
Dušan Laznik (Mentis) (laznik) wrote :

Hello,
I am on revision 7953.
When I try to open menu item Manufacturing in Settings I still get the error:

OpenERP Server Error
Client Traceback (most recent call last):
  File "/home/dusan/OpenERP/web/addons/web/http.py", line 174, in dispatch
    response["result"] = method(self, **self.params)
  File "/home/dusan/OpenERP/web/addons/web/controllers/main.py", line 1265, in call_kw
    return self._call_kw(req, model, method, args, kwargs)
  File "/home/dusan/OpenERP/web/addons/web/controllers/main.py", line 1227, in _call_kw
    return getattr(req.session.model(model), method)(*args, **kwargs)
  File "/home/dusan/OpenERP/web/addons/web/session.py", line 42, in proxy
    result = self.proxy.execute_kw(self.session._db, self.session._uid, self.session._password, self.model, method, args, kw)
  File "/home/dusan/OpenERP/web/addons/web/session.py", line 30, in proxy_method
    result = self.session.send(self.service_name, method, *args)
  File "/home/dusan/OpenERP/web/addons/web/session.py", line 105, in send
    raise xmlrpclib.Fault(openerp.tools.exception_to_unicode(e), formatted_info)

Server Traceback (most recent call last):
  File "/home/dusan/OpenERP/web/addons/web/session.py", line 91, in send
    return openerp.netsvc.dispatch_rpc(service_name, method, args)
  File "/home/dusan/OpenERP/server/openerp/netsvc.py", line 361, in dispatch_rpc
    result = ExportService.getService(service_name).dispatch(method, params)
  File "/home/dusan/OpenERP/server/openerp/service/web_services.py", line 585, in dispatch
    res = fn(db, uid, *params)
  File "/home/dusan/OpenERP/server/openerp/osv/osv.py", line 167, in execute_kw
    return self.execute(db, uid, obj, method, *args, **kw or {})
  File "/home/dusan/OpenERP/server/openerp/osv/osv.py", line 121, in wrapper
    return f(self, dbname, *args, **kwargs)
  File "/home/dusan/OpenERP/server/openerp/osv/osv.py", line 176, in execute
    res = self.execute_cr(cr, uid, obj, method, *args, **kw)
  File "/home/dusan/OpenERP/server/openerp/osv/osv.py", line 164, in execute_cr
    return getattr(object, method)(cr, uid, *args, **kw)
  File "/home/dusan/OpenERP/server/openerp/addons/base/res/res_config.py", line 478, in default_get
    classified = self._get_classified_fields(cr, uid, context)
  File "/home/dusan/OpenERP/server/openerp/addons/base/res/res_config.py", line 470, in _get_classified_fields
    modules.append((name, ir_module.browse(cr, uid, mod_ids[0], context)))
IndexError: list index out of range

est regards !

Revision history for this message
Serpent Consulting Services (serpent-consulting-services) wrote :

On revision 7988, this one is fixed by Cedric.

Thanks.

summary: - [trunk] 7.0 Error on opening Manufacturing in Serttings
+ [trunk] 7.0 Error on opening Manufacturing in Settings
Changed in openobject-addons:
milestone: none → 7.0
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Duplicates of this bug

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.